An accurate check of the wheel alignment is carried out in a car service. The camber and angle of inclination of the axis of rotation are provided by the suspension design and are not subject to adjustment (data is for verification purposes only). On your own, you can only roughly check and adjust the toe-in of the front wheels, for which you need a special ruler. The ruler measures the difference in distance between the inner surfaces of the tires in the center of the wheels (before measuring, the wheels are set to the driving position in a straight line, the loading of the car on the driver's and passenger's seats should be 70 kg each, the tank is half filled, the tire pressure should be correct, there should be no noticeable play in the wheel bearings). First check the tire spacing at the rear of the wheel, mark the marks, then roll the car so that the marks are at the front. Toe-in adjustment is provided by turning the steering rods with the locknuts loosened. Toe-in is checked after every ¼ turn of the rod.
The convergence and camber of the rear wheels are only checked and cannot be adjusted.
